Colin D. Howell is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, History and Gender Studies. According to data from OpenAlex, Colin D. Howell has authored 31 papers receiving a total of 306 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Sociology and Political Science, 11 papers in History and 11 papers in Gender Studies. Recurrent topics in Colin D. Howell's work include Sports, Gender, and Society (11 papers), Canadian Identity and History (10 papers) and Sport and Mega-Event Impacts (8 papers). Colin D. Howell is often cited by papers focused on Sports, Gender, and Society (11 papers), Canadian Identity and History (10 papers) and Sport and Mega-Event Impacts (8 papers). Colin D. Howell coll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and United Kingdom. Colin D. Howell's co-authors include Bruce Kidd, Sandra Kirby, S. W. Squyres, Michael C. Liu, Jack J. Lissauer, Diane V. Michelangeli, Ronald J. Thomas, Mark Allen, Wendy Mitchinson and R. F. Beebe and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, The American Historical Review and Icarus.
